Output 8af5c126c56da4f8ed9f0c569ac1fa3040f13887bcf73442aa243398c5607886:4

value
2357185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d832ce28916462c102c5cd1bb79ff0206a56e47 OP_EQUAL
address
3D8fXk8MgjWoP3Nt965zbMJm6Y6BncVupC
transaction
8af5c126c56da4f8ed9f0c569ac1fa3040f13887bcf73442aa243398c5607886
spent
true